The largest number of tiger reserves is located in?
1. Karnataka
2. Madhya Pradesh
3. West Bengal
4. Andhra Pradesh

Correct Answer - Option 2 : Madhya Pradesh

The correct answer is Madhya Pradesh.

  • The state of Madhya Pradesh has the highest number of Tiger reserves in India (6 tiger reserves).

  • The tiger reserves in India are governed under Project Tiger which is administrated by the National Tiger Conservation Authority.
  • About 80% of the tigers in the world are found in India. 
  • Tiger reserves in Madhya Pradesh are:
    • Kanha Tiger Reserve
    • Pench Tiger Reserve
    • Panna Tiger Reserve
    • Bandhavgarh Tiger Reserve
    • Satpuda Tiger Reserve
    • Sanjay Tiger Reserve

  • The National Tiger Conservation Authority:
    • The National Tiger Conservation Authority was established in December 2005.
    • It was established on the recommendation of the Tiger Task Force constituted by the Prime Minister of India for reorganised management of Project Tiger and the Tiger Reserves in India.
  • Project Tiger :
    • ​Project Tiger was launched by the Government of India in the year 1973 to save the endangered species of tiger in the country. Starting from nine (9) reserves in 1973-2016 the number is grown up to fifty (50).
  • ​Total Tiger reserves in India: 51
  • According to the Tiger Census 2018:
    • Madhya Pradesh became the Tiger state of India with 526 Tigers.
    • Karnataka is the second position with 524 Royal Bengal Tiger population.
    • Uttrakhand is third with 442 Tigers Population.
